Summary of Key Insights

Papa's Burgeria To Go! is generally well-received, with a strong nostalgic appeal and addictive gameplay. However, the app suffers from significant technical issues, particularly freezing and glitches, which severely impact user experience. Users also express a desire for more content, features, and graphical updates to bring it in line with newer Papa Louie games. While the core gameplay is enjoyable, addressing the technical problems and content limitations is crucial for maintaining a positive user experience and attracting new players. The sentiment is mixed, with many 5-star reviews balanced by 1-3 star reviews highlighting game-breaking bugs.

  • Overall Rating: Approximately 4.1 out of 5 stars based on the score distribution.
  • Strengths: Addictive gameplay, nostalgic appeal, easy-to-learn mechanics.
  • Weaknesses: Frequent freezing and glitches, outdated graphics, limited content, lack of character customization, and limited replayability after purchasing all upgrades.
  • Sentiment: Positive overall, but with significant frustration due to technical issues.
  • Score Distribution: 5-star (54.6%), 4-star (23%), 3-star (11.6%), 2-star (3.4%), 1-star (7.4%).

Key User Pain Points

  • Freezing and Glitches: The most prevalent complaint, particularly within the grill station. Burgers stop cooking, timers freeze, buttons disappear, and the game becomes unresponsive. This forces users to restart, losing progress.
  • Outdated Graphics: Many users mention the blurry or low-quality graphics, especially compared to newer Papa Louie games. This detracts from the overall enjoyment and visual appeal.
  • Limited Content: After a certain point (around day 20-60), users find that they've purchased all available upgrades and unlocked all toppings, leading to a lack of motivation to continue playing.
  • Burger Build Station Issues: Some users find it hard to get perfect scores in the build station.
  • Small Screen Issues: Some complaints mention the small size of the order tickets, making them difficult to read.
  • Refund Issues: Some users who have experienced problems with the game have had difficulty obtaining refunds.

Frequently Requested Features

  • More Papa Louie Games: Users overwhelmingly request mobile versions of other Papa Louie games, particularly Papa's Freezeria, Cupcakeria, Wingeria, Taco Mia, and Hot Doggeria.
  • Character Customization: A highly desired feature, allowing players to personalize their in-game avatar, similar to newer titles.
  • Additional Content: More toppings, ingredients, recipes, and upgrades to extend gameplay and provide new challenges.
  • Mini-Games: Inclusion of mini-games, as seen in some of the PC versions, to add variety and replayability.
  • Graphics Update: Higher resolution and improved visuals to enhance the gaming experience.
  • Additional Stations: Adding more stations like fries, drinks, or sides to make the game more complex and realistic.
  • Save Game Functionality: Improved saving to prevent loss of progress due to crashes or glitches.
